The final of the Chessable Masters started with Ding Liren giving 16-year-old Rameshbabu Praggnanandhaa a tough test just hours after the talented youngster sat a real-life school exam. The Chinese star showed exactly why he’s ranked world number 2 with a cool and classy display to take the first of two matches of the Meltwater […]
